植物光合作用制造的有机物,往往被光呼吸作用消耗三分之一以上。因此,抑制光呼吸,提高净光合产物,是农作物增产的新途径。抑制光呼吸的化学药剂,目前在我国大田作物上应用较多的是亚硫酸氢钠,因为它无毒性、价廉容易买到,使用简便,喷施作物后增产效果显著,故被广泛采用。综合全国各地喷施亚硫酸氢钠的试验资料,充分说明它的增产效果是可靠的。如黑龙江省农科院大豆所,于1974—1977年用100PPM 浓度的亚硫酸氢钠溶液喷洒大豆,获得增产10—15%的效果,并有促进早熟的作用;1980年,黑龙江省农技站在225个点连续对大豆进行喷施亚硫酸氢钠试验
